Understanding Laser Dentistry

Laser dentistry involves the use of dental lasers, which emit a concentrated beam of light, to perform dental procedures. These lasers can precisely cut or reshape tissue, making them a versatile tool in both soft tissue and hard tissue treatments. Benefits of Laser Dentistry

Laser dentistry offers several significant benefits that improve the overall patient experience:

  1. Precision: One of the most notable advantages of laser dentistry is its precision. Lasers allow dentists to target specific areas without affecting the surrounding tissues. This precision leads to more accurate and effective treatments.
  2. Reduced Pain and Discomfort: Laser procedures are minimally invasive, resulting in less pain and discomfort for patients. The focused energy minimizes the need for sutures and reduces post-operative pain.
  3. Faster Healing and Recovery: Because laser treatments are less invasive, they often result in quicker healing times. Patients experience less swelling and bleeding, which contributes to a faster recovery.
  4. Lower Risk of Infection: The high-energy laser beam sterilizes the treatment area, reducing the risk of bacterial infections. This is particularly beneficial for procedures involving gum tissue.
  5. Less Anesthesia Needed: Many laser dental procedures require little to no anesthesia, making the experience more comfortable for patients and reducing potential side effects associated with anesthesia.

Applications of Laser Dentistry

The versatility of laser technology allows it to be used in a wide range of dental procedures:

  1. Tooth Decay Removal: Lasers can precisely remove decayed tissue from a tooth before placing a filling, preserving more of the healthy tooth structure.
  2. Gum Disease Treatment: Laser therapy is effective in treating gum disease by removing infected tissue and promoting the regeneration of healthy gum tissue.
  3. Biopsies and Lesion Removal: Lasers can be used to perform biopsies or remove oral lesions with minimal discomfort and faster healing times.
  4. Teeth Whitening: Laser-activated whitening agents can speed up the teeth whitening process, providing quick and effective results.
  5. Pediatric Dentistry: Laser dentistry is particularly beneficial for children, offering a less intimidating and more comfortable experience for young patients.
